In a computer generated guessing game, the player should guess a number between 1 and 20. The player has 5 guesses. The player wins if the difference between two or more guesses with the actual number is smaller than or equal to 3 Ex: The number to be guessed is 9. The player's guesses are [2, 14, 10, 7, 3]. Since 10 is larger than 9 by 1, and 7 is smaller than 9 by 2, the player has won this set of the game. Write a function called Number Guess() that takes the number to be guessed and a player's guess array, calculates if the winning criteria is met, and returns logical 1 for if the player wins and logical O if the player did not. function win = NumberGuess(gameNum, userGuess)

   % Write a function that takes the elements of the row array of user's guesses

   % and calculate if the difference of 2 or more of guesses is less than  3.

   

   % Calculate the absolute value of difference between 'gameNum' and each element

   % of userGuess

   D = abs(userGuess-gameNum);

   

   % Calculate the number of guesses which differes the 'gameNum' by 3 or less

   N = numel(D(D<=3));

   

   % Check whether N is greater than or equal to 2

   win = N>=2;

end

What is a request for proposal (RFP)?A request for proposal (RFP) is a document that a company—often a large corporation or government agency—posts to request formal bids from vendors for the IT solution they require. Each assessment factor that will be used to evaluate a vendor's proposal is listed in the RFP along with the client's specifications. A standard request for proposals (RFP) contains background information on the issuing organization and its lines of business (LOBs), a list of specifications detailing the ideal solution, and evaluation criteria outlining how offers will be assessed. An explanation of the scope of the work or the range of services to be offered is contained in the request for proposals (RFP) part known as the statement of work.The tasks and deadlines for the deliverables that the chosen bidder must meet are listed in this section. Along with instructions on how to create a proposal, the request for proposals also contains this information. Details on the proposal format and guidelines for creating and organizing the RFP response are provided in this section.

In the context of business, a target cost is understood as the highest cost that should be incurred when producing a good after accounting for desired profits. It is usually chosen for brand-new products and is regarded as a customer-focused pricing strategy.Target costing calculates product costs by deducting a desired profit margin from a price that is competitive in the market. The target cost is fundamentally customer-focused and a crucial idea for new product development because it refers to the competitive market.

A spillway is a structure that allows for the controlled flow of water from a dam or levee downstream, usually into the dammed river's actual riverbed. They could be referred to as overflow channels in the UK. Spillways protect the structure's non-water-conveying components from harm caused by water.

Floodgates and fuse plugs are examples of spillways that can be used to control reservoir level and water flow. By releasing water gradually before the reservoir is full, operators can prevent an uncomfortably big discharge later. Such features allow a spillway to regulate downstream flow.

The term "spillway" is also used to describe outlet channels cut through natural dams like moraines, bypasses of dams utilized during high water, and exits of waterways.

What is a toolpath?

The single most crucial element in CNC milling is called a toolpath, which is the data that the milling machine uses to direct the drill bit through the material.

The way that toolpaths function is like a vector; they have a direction, a size, and a position in space. The direction and location of the milling bit in space are directly reflected by these. Toolpaths come in two flavors: 2D and 3D.

An equivalent of a cookie cutter operation, 2D toolpaths for cutting from 2D "sheet" material only operate in the X and Y directions.

In comparison to 3D objects, 2D cuts can be machined much more quickly.

Because the machine only works from the top down, it is very limited in the variety of 3D forms it can fabricate. 3D toolpaths work in the X, Y, and Z directions and are for sculpting and excavating a material, which is a laborious process because each layer must be removed.

Because its gain is always negative, the inverting operational amplifier is essentially a constant or fixed-gain amplifier that produces a negative output voltage.

This extremely high gain, though, is of little use to us because it makes the amplifier unstable and difficult to control because even the smallest input signals—a few microvolts (V)—would be enough to cause the output voltage to saturate and swing toward one of the voltage supply rails, causing the output to become completely uncontrollable.

An appropriate resistor connected across the amplifier from the output terminal back to the inverting input terminal can be used to reduce and regulate the overall gain of the amplifier because the open loop DC gain of an operational amplifier is extremely high. The result is what is commonly known as negative feedback.

What is Wind Shear?

Wind shear, also known as wind gradient, is a variation in wind speed and/or direction across a short distance in the atmosphere. Vertical or horizontal wind shear is commonly used to describe atmospheric wind shear.

Wind shear is significant since it might jeopardize your flight's safety. The greatest issue in the high atmosphere is turbulence, but at lower altitudes, particularly during landing/takeoff, the key concern is avoiding mishaps induced by increases in wind shear.
